Seungjin Kim is the New Chair of the Council of Advisors of the NEA Global Forum on Nuclear Education, Science, Technology and Policy

Seungjin Kim, professor and Capt. James F. McCarthy, Jr. and Cheryl E. McCarthy Head of the School of Nuclear Engineering, has been unanimously elected as the new Chair of the Council of Advisors of the Nuclear Energy Agency (NEA) Global Forum on Nuclear Education, Science, Technology and Policy.

In this role, Kim will use his extensive background, expertise and experience to lead the Global Forum’s Council of Advisors into the next phase of program work. 

Established in 2021, the NEA Global Forum serves as a vital platform for collaboration among academic institutions, policymakers, and key stakeholders within the nuclear energy sector. It is led by the Council of Advisors, representatives from over 20 influential global universities with nuclear education programs. Together, the group of leaders aim to address existing gaps by facilitating shared activities and programs, conducting studies related to the future of the nuclear sector, and holding symposia to discuss emerging issues and creative solutions related to nuclear science and technology, education, and policy. NEA Global Forum is one of 17 global forums operating within the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D).
